Traditional metal braces can tolerate more pressure than newer ceramic ones. Thus, metal braces are recommended for a more severe correction. Does the word braces call to mind a teenager with a mouth full of metal ? These days, people of all ages want to straighten their teeth. Metal and ceramic braces function the same. Each type applies pressure to the teeth causing the teeth to move over a period of months or years, says the Cleveland Clinic.


Ceramic Braces vs Metal Braces and Your Appearance.

On average, this can take about one to three years. It means that both braces have the same effect and result in straightening the teeth. The only difference is that the price of ceramics is higher than that of traditional metal braces. In addition, ceramic braces are not as strong as metal braces.
